Analysis

The most recent figure for outbound mobility ratio to central and eastern europe, adjusted in GPE: Overall Fy24, All 90 Countries, December 2024 is 0.3243 GPIA, measured in 2023.

That represents a change of up 2.9% on the previous year and up 2.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, outbound mobility ratio to central and eastern europe, adjusted in GPE: Overall Fy24, All 90 Countries, December 2024 peaked at 0.3675 GPIA in 2017 and was at its lowest, 0.2698 GPIA, in 2011.

That places GPE: Overall Fy24, All 90 Countries, December 2024 144th out of 217 groups with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 13 years of available data.

Outbound mobility ratio to Central and Eastern Europe, adjusted in GPE: Overall Fy24, All 90 Countries, December 2024, year by year

Annual values for Outbound mobility ratio to Central and Eastern Europe, adjusted gender parity index (GPIA) in GPE: Overall Fy24, All 90 Countries, December 2024, 2011 to 2023.
Year GPIA Change
2011 0.2698 GPIA
2012 0.2787 GPIA +3.3%
2013 0.3159 GPIA +13.3%
2014 0.3615 GPIA +14.5%
2015 0.3341 GPIA -7.6%
2016 0.3267 GPIA -2.2%
2017 0.3675 GPIA +12.5%
2018 0.3109 GPIA -15.4%
2019 0.331 GPIA +6.5%
2020 0.2986 GPIA -9.8%
2021 0.313 GPIA +4.8%
2022 0.3151 GPIA +0.7%
2023 0.3243 GPIA +2.9%
